Post 10 September

How to Achieve Seamless Integration: Linking E-Commerce Platforms with ERP Systems

Integrating e-commerce platforms with Enterprise Resource Planning (ERP) systems is essential for streamlining operations, enhancing data accuracy, and improving overall efficiency. This integration ensures that sales data, inventory levels, and customer information are synchronized across platforms, leading to better decision-making and a more cohesive business operation. Here’s how to achieve seamless integration between e-commerce platforms and ERP systems:

1. Assess Integration Needs and Objectives

– Identify Goals: Define what you aim to achieve with the integration, such as real-time inventory updates, automated order processing, or consolidated financial reporting.
– Evaluate Current Systems: Review the capabilities and limitations of your existing e-commerce and ERP systems. Determine the specific integration points and data flows needed to meet your objectives.

2. Choose the Right Integration Approach

– Direct Integration: For simpler setups, use native integration solutions provided by either the e-commerce platform or ERP system. Many modern platforms offer built-in connectors or APIs for seamless integration.
– Middleware Solutions: Use middleware or integration platforms as a service (iPaaS) for more complex integrations. Middleware acts as an intermediary that facilitates data exchange between e-commerce and ERP systems.
– Custom Integration: Develop a custom integration solution if your needs are unique or if off-the-shelf solutions do not fully meet your requirements. Custom integrations can be tailored to specific workflows and data requirements.

3. Implement Data Mapping and Synchronization

– Define Data Mapping: Map out the data fields and formats between the e-commerce platform and ERP system. Ensure that data such as orders, inventory levels, customer information, and payment details are accurately transferred and synchronized.
– Set Up Synchronization Rules: Establish rules for data synchronization, including frequency (real-time or scheduled), conflict resolution, and data validation to ensure consistency and accuracy.

4. Test Integration Thoroughly

– Conduct Testing: Perform comprehensive testing of the integration to identify and resolve any issues before going live. Test scenarios should include order processing, inventory updates, and customer data synchronization.
– Monitor Performance: After implementation, continuously monitor the integration to ensure it performs as expected. Address any issues promptly to maintain seamless operation.

5. Train and Support Staff

– Provide Training: Ensure that staff are trained on the new integrated system and understand how to use it effectively. Training should cover new processes, tools, and any changes to workflows.
– Offer Support: Provide ongoing support to address any questions or issues that arise during and after the integration process. Ensure that there are clear channels for reporting and resolving problems.

6. Ensure Compliance and Security

– Data Security: Implement robust security measures to protect sensitive data during integration. Ensure compliance with data protection regulations such as GDPR or CCPA.
– Regulatory Compliance: Verify that the integration meets all relevant industry regulations and standards, including financial reporting requirements and data handling protocols.

7. Optimize and Update

– Continuous Improvement: Regularly review and optimize the integration to improve performance and address any emerging needs or changes in business processes.
– Stay Updated: Keep both the e-commerce platform and ERP system updated with the latest features and security patches to ensure ongoing compatibility and functionality.

By carefully planning and executing the integration process, you can achieve a seamless connection between your e-commerce platform and ERP system, leading to improved operational efficiency, better data accuracy, and enhanced customer satisfaction.